The county is rich in history, with its name possibly rooted in Native American languages. Escambia County covers a vast area of 951 square miles and is home to significant natural landmarks like the Conecuh River.
With a population of around 36,757 residents, Escambia County is governed by an elected five-member commission. The county features various incorporated communities, offering diverse opportunities and resources to its residents. Escambia County is known for its proximity to the Conecuh National Forest and the Poarch Creek Indian Reservation.
